| Obverse description | The Public Seal of Niue rendered in high relief at center, depicting a stylized floral motif within a beaded circular border surmounted by a crown, the whole enclosed within a decorative cartouche flanked by crossed palm fronds. A ribbon scroll below bears the legend ATUA NIUE TUKULAGI. The denomination TWO DOLLARS arcs along the upper field, and the date 2025 appears in the lower field. |

| Reverse description | A broad, double-edged sword depicted in high relief, point upward, superimposed over a dark-field heraldic shield bearing Hebrew lettering. The composition is framed by a concentric dotted ring bordered by an outer wreath of olive or laurel branches. The legend ONE TROY OUNCE arcs along the lower left field and .9999 FINE SILVER along the lower right, with the inscription AND TO COME TO KNOWLEDGE appearing near the crossguard of the sword. |
